Maxim Integrated MAX5068AUT-T High-Frequency 100V Half-Bridge NMOS Driver
The MAX5068AUT-T from Maxim Integrated is a sophisticated high-frequency, 100V half-bridge NMOS FET driver designed to cater to a wide array of applications, including but not limited to, telecom and networking systems, industrial control, and automotive environments. This high-performance driver is engineered to provide robust and efficient control for half-bridge topologies, a common configuration in power electronics.
With its ability to operate at high frequencies, the MAX5068AUT-T ensures swift and precise switching, which is critical for reducing power losses and improving overall efficiency in power conversion systems. The driver is capable of driving two NMOS transistors in a half-bridge arrangement, making it a versatile component for implementing various power conversion strategies such as DC-DC converters, motor drivers, and Class-D amplifiers.
The MAX5068AUT-T boasts an extended operating voltage range, accommodating supply voltages from 4.5V to 15V, which allows for flexible integration into different system designs. Its high 100V maximum bootstrap voltage ensures that it can handle high voltage applications with ease, providing a reliable solution for systems that require high voltage tolerances.
One of the key features of the MAX5068AUT-T is its adaptive non-overlapping gate drive, which prevents simultaneous conduction of the NMOS transistors, thereby eliminating the risk of shoot-through and protecting the integrity of the power stage. Additionally, the device is equipped with an integrated bootstrap diode, further simplifying the circuit design and reducing external component count.
The compact SOT23-6 package of the MAX5068AUT-T makes it an excellent choice for space-constrained applications. Its small footprint, combined with its high performance and robustness, ensures that it can deliver optimal performance even in the most demanding environments.
